首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

是否可以将Projection_traits_xy_3适配器与"2D Polyline simplify“软件包一起使用,以简化2.5D Polyline?

Projection_traits_xy_3适配器是CGAL(Computational Geometry Algorithms Library)中的一个适配器,用于将3D点投影到2D平面上进行计算。它可以与各种几何算法一起使用,包括2D Polyline simplify软件包。

"2D Polyline simplify"软件包是一个用于简化2D Polyline(折线)的工具,它可以减少折线中的顶点数量,从而实现对2D Polyline的简化。

因此,可以将Projection_traits_xy_3适配器与"2D Polyline simplify"软件包一起使用,以简化2.5D Polyline。通过使用Projection_traits_xy_3适配器,可以将2.5D Polyline投影到2D平面上,然后使用"2D Polyline simplify"软件包对其进行简化。

这样做的优势是可以减少2.5D Polyline中的顶点数量,从而降低数据的复杂性和存储需求,同时提高计算效率和渲染性能。

适用场景包括地理信息系统(GIS)、计算机辅助设计(CAD)、计算机图形学等领域,其中需要对大规模的2.5D Polyline数据进行处理和展示。

腾讯云相关产品中,可以使用云服务器(CVM)提供计算资源,云数据库MySQL(CDB)提供数据存储和管理,云存储(COS)提供文件存储服务,云网络(VPC)提供网络通信支持。具体产品介绍和链接如下:

  • 云服务器(CVM):提供弹性计算能力,支持自定义配置和管理。详情请参考:腾讯云服务器
  • 云数据库MySQL(CDB):提供高可用、可扩展的关系型数据库服务,适用于数据存储和管理。详情请参考:腾讯云数据库MySQL
  • 云存储(COS):提供安全、稳定的对象存储服务,适用于文件存储和管理。详情请参考:腾讯云存储COS
  • 云网络(VPC):提供灵活的网络配置和管理,支持构建私有网络环境。详情请参考:腾讯云网络VPC

请注意,以上仅为腾讯云的一些相关产品示例,其他云计算品牌商也提供类似的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

基于 HTML5 WebGL GIS 的智慧机场大数据可视化分析

在航空领域,机场、航班和航线信息是至关重要的数据,本文介绍 HT 为平台,应用 JavaScript、HTML5、GIS 等技术开发的全球航线实例。 界面预览 - 主界面 ?...- 航线生成 在生成航线时,使用了 ht.Polyline 类型,该类型支持三维空间点描述,而且结合 segments 参数,实现了从二维平面曲线延伸到三维空间曲线的效果。...通过下图可以看出椭圆上任意一点 A 内切圆上的 A1 点有相同的纵坐标,外切圆上的 A2 点有相同的横坐标,所以 A 点的坐标就可以描述为 (a * cosθ,b * sinθ),其中 θ 是椭圆内切圆或者外切圆的圆心角...Logo 和光晕的旋转使用了 3D 旋转函数,具体使用方法可以参照 HT 3D 手册 中的 3D 旋转函数部分。...因此使用 setTimout 保证更新的最短间隔为 50ms,去掉不必要的更新。当然这个间隔可以根据实际情况调整,以降低视觉上的迟钝感。

1.3K20

基于HTML5和WebGL的3D网络拓扑结构图

在医疗行业使用它们制作器官的精确模型;电影行业将它们用于活动的人物、物体以及现实电影;视频游戏产业将它们作为计算机视频游戏中的资源;在科学领域将它们作为化合物的精确模型;建筑业将它们用来展示提议的建筑物或者风景表现...它们可以在三维建模工具中使用或者单独使用。...为了容易形成动画,通常在模型中加入一些额外的数据,例如,一些人类或者动物的三维模型中有完整的骨骼系统,这样运动时看起来会更加真实,并且可以通过关节骨骼控制运动。...我是在网上down下来的obj格式的文件,然后我利用HT中的ht.Default.loadObj(objUrl, mtlUrl, params)函数模型加载进去,其中的params部分可以参考http...想让2d图片在3d管线上移动则是使用g3d.toViewPosition(position)来获取3d模型的二维坐标,这个函数中的参数就是三维模型的3d坐标,我们可以直接polyline管线上的点传入

1.6K50

ArcGIS API for JavaScript应用开发

,3.x是一个2D版本,编程思路差异还是比较大的。...:http://localhost/ArcGIS/rest/services/zy/MapServer,可以将该地址复制到浏览器地址查看是否正确。...三、在地图上绘制图形 自绘制图形即Graphic对象,一般都创建在GraphicLayer,每个Map至少缺省带一个GraphicLayer,可以创建多个,实现分层管理,但在某个具体的业务中,业务数据组织在一个图层中是有便利的...//设置图层目标单击事件处理程序 //这里是事件关联处理程序定义在一起的做法。...由于使用Dojo对Javascript的部分能力进行了封装,因此,要理解其原理,必须理解以下几个Dojo命令,这都属于Dojo的core部分,由于Dojo也在不断发展,需注意现行版本以前的区别。

2.6K30

基于HTML5和WebGL的3D网络拓扑结构图

在医疗行业使用它们制作器官的精确模型;电影行业将它们用于活动的人物、物体以及现实电影;视频游戏产业将它们作为计算机视频游戏中的资源;在科学领域将它们作为化合物的精确模型;建筑业将它们用来展示提议的建筑物或者风景表现...它们可以在三维建模工具中使用或者单独使用。...为了容易形成动画,通常在模型中加入一些额外的数据,例如,一些人类或者动物的三维模型中有完整的骨骼系统,这样运动时看起来会更加真实,并且可以通过关节骨骼控制运动。...我是在网上down下来的obj格式的文件,然后我利用HT中的ht.Default.loadObj(objUrl, mtlUrl, params)函数模型加载进去,其中的params部分可以参考http...想让2d图片在3d管线上移动则是使用g3d.toViewPosition(position)来获取3d模型的二维坐标,这个函数中的参数就是三维模型的3d坐标,我们可以直接polyline管线上的点传入

1.3K30

腾讯地图手把手教你实现微信小程序路线规划

前言 本文旨在mpvue框架为基础,探讨地图类小程序的开发思路。...npm 外部依赖 使用 Vue.js 命令行工具 vue-cli 快速初始化项目 H5 代码转换编译成小程序目标代码的能力 就个人使用体验来看,还是挺丝滑顺畅的,传统web应用开发无缝切换至小程序开发...这两个组件也是原生组件,但是使用限制与其他原生组件有所不同。 笔者就因为这个坑耽误了不少时间,有时候开发工具可以用,但到了真机上组件就完全乱了,所以还是要以真机调试为准。...map可以定义多个参数,经纬度不用说,scale指放缩比例,也就是地图比例尺,polyline在地图上绘制折线,markers用于标记地图上的点,show-location用于显示用户所在位置,show-compass...(以下代码经过简化处理): 第一步,初始化地图SDK对象 import config from '@/config' import QQMapWX from '../..

1.4K41

基于 HTML5 WebGL 的故宫人流量动态监控系统

index.js 是 src 下的入口文件,创建了一个 由 main.js 中导出的 Main 类,Main 类中创建 3D 组件和 2D 组件,利用 g2d.deserialize() 方法 json...在飞鸟动画实现的前提下,接下来我们可以进一步飞鸟模型为中心来生成鸟瞰漫游动画。...在 HT for Web 中为 3D 组件提供了 enablePostProcessing() 方法,使用可以通过调用该方法手动开启 3D 场景的景深模糊效果,另外还可以通过设置 aperture 属性改变景深模糊度...热力图特殊高亮的形式显示游客所在的地理区域的图示,可以非常直观的展示人流量密度信息。...3.使用 createThermodynamicNode() 方法按照热力图渲染数据创建热力图。4.热力图添加到数据容器中。 视频监控 ?

82910

原 荐 基于 HTML5 Canvas 的交

当然,如果有什么意见的可以直接跟我说,大家一起交流才会进步。...创建一个 ht.Polyline 管线,我们可以通过 polyline.addPoint() 函数向这个变量中添加具体的点,通过 setSegments 可以设置点的连接方式。...top” dm.add(polyline);//管线添加进数据容器中储存,不然这个管线属于“游离”状态,是不会显示在拓扑图上的 return polyline; } 上面代码中添加地铁线上的点有分为几种情况...false, 0.00001);//自适应大小,参数1为是否动画,参数2为gv边框的padding值 gv.setMovableFunc(function(){ return false;//...,参数1为自适应的节点,参数2为是否动画,参数3为gv边框的padding } else if(e.kind === 'doubleClickBackground') {//双击空白处

98340

基于 HTML5 WebGL 的故宫人流量动态监控系统

index.js 是 src 下的入口文件,创建了一个 由 main.js 中导出的 Main 类,Main 类中创建 3D 组件和 2D 组件,利用 g2d.deserialize() 方法 json...在飞鸟动画实现的前提下,接下来我们可以进一步飞鸟模型为中心来生成鸟瞰漫游动画。...在 HT for Web 中为 3D 组件提供了 enablePostProcessing() 方法,使用可以通过调用该方法手动开启 3D 场景的景深模糊效果,另外还可以通过设置 aperture 属性改变景深模糊度...热力图特殊高亮的形式显示游客所在的地理区域的图示,可以非常直观的展示人流量密度信息。...3.使用 createThermodynamicNode() 方法按照热力图渲染数据创建热力图。4.热力图添加到数据容器中。 视频监控 ?

87210

SVG 入门指南(初学者入门必备)

SVG 简介 SVG,即可缩放矢量图形(Scalable Vector Graphics),是一种 XML 应用,可以一种简洁、可移植的形式表示图形信息。目前,人们对 SVG 越来越感兴趣。...这一系列也称为 位图,通过某种压缩格式存储。由于大多数现代显示设备也是栅格设备,显示图像时仅需要一个阅读器位图解压并将它传输到屏幕上。 ?...其他基本图形 如下图所示,咱们使用 元素构建嘴和耳朵,它接受一对 x 和 y 坐标为 points 属性的值。你可以使用空格或者逗号分隔这些数值。...具体可以采用两种方法:图像包含在 元素内(当图像是页面的基本组成部分时,推荐这种方式);或者图像作为另一个元素的 CSS 样式属性插入(当图像主要用来装饰时,推荐这种方式)。...='black' stroke-width='2'/> 分组引用对象 虽然可以所有的绘图看成是由一系列几乎一样的形状和线条组成的,但通常咱们还是认为大多数非抽象的艺术作品是由一系列命名对象组成的

3.3K21

SVG 入门指南(看完,对SVG结构不在陌生)

这一系列也称为 位图,通过某种压缩格式存储。由于大多数现代显示设备也是栅格设备,显示图像时仅需要一个阅读器位图解压并将它传输到屏幕上。...你可以使用空格或者逗号分隔这些数值。...具体可以采用两种方法:图像包含在 元素内(当图像是页面的基本组成部分时,推荐这种方式);或者图像作为另一个元素的 CSS 样式属性插入(当图像主要用来装饰时,推荐这种方式)。...='black' stroke-width='2'/> 分组引用对象 虽然可以所有的绘图看成是由一系列几乎一样的形状和线条组成的,但通常咱们还是认为大多数非抽象的艺术作品是由一系列命名对象组成的... 元素可以解决这些问题 1)SVG规范推荐我们所有想要复用的对象放置在元素内,这样SVG阅读器进入流式环境中就能更轻松地处理数据。

2.7K20

基于 HTML5 WebGL 的 3D 网络拓扑结构图

在医疗行业使用它们制作器官的精确模型;电影行业将它们用于活动的人物、物体以及现实电影;视频游戏产业将它们作为计算机视频游戏中的资源;在科学领域将它们作为化合物的精确模型;建筑业将它们用来展示提议的建筑物或者风景表现...它们可以在三维建模工具中使用或者单独使用。...为了容易形成动画,通常在模型中加入一些额外的数据,例如,一些人类或者动物的三维模型中有完整的骨骼系统,这样运动时看起来会更加真实,并且可以通过关节骨骼控制运动。.../机柜组件1.obj', 'obj/机柜组件1.mtl', { //加载 obj 文件 cube: true, //是否模型缩放到单位1的尺寸范围内,默认为false center...;//获取曲线的总长度 polyline.a('length', lineLength - 50);//因为我设置了edge的t3(相当于2d中的offset),所以线段长度实际没有那么长

1.2K20

WPF性能优化:形状(Shape)、几何图形(Geometry)和图画(Drawing)的使用

尽管Polyline是非闭合的形状,但是设置了Fill属性时,Points属性中最后一个连接点和开始点形成的不可见虚拟线段Polyline绘制的折线形成的闭合区间也会被填充。...="3"/> Polygon 绘制多边形,Polyline相似,有多条直线段组成形成闭合区域。...Polyline唯一的区别就是Polygon会把Points属性中最后一个连接点和开始点连接起来。...GeometryGroup 由多个几何图形(Geometry)组合在一起形成几何图形组,实现为单个路径(Path)添加任意多个几何图形(Geometry),可以使用EvenOdd或者NonZero填充规则来确定要填充的区域...CombinedGeometry 两个几何图形合并为一个形状。可以使用CombineMode属性选择如何组合两个几何图形。

1.5K10

告别传统工业互联网,提高数字管控思维:三维组态分布式能源站

可以自定义修改一些交互或者视角上的限制,如修改左右键的交互方式或者设置场景的最大仰角,都能使用户在交互体验上更为流畅。...,我们可以通过 ht.PolyLine 绘制出流程所经的路径,通过 ht.Default.startAnim() 动画函数去执行调用变化管道上的 uv 贴图的偏移值,就可以达到流动的效果。...billboard 同样是基于 ht.Shape 的子类,对于 Shape 不管是在 2D 组态或者是 3D 组态上呈现,都可以通过一些定义的属性 styleMap 来设定一些本身自带的属性值,当然用户也可以自己通过在...为了给精彩的 HTML web 组态添加上绚丽的颜色,HT 在 2D 组态 和 3D 组态 上不断地完善,可以通过 2/3D 融合的场景图纸搭建出一个个好玩的可视化系统。...而作为在 3D 组态上可以呈现出多样化效果下搭建的可视化系统场景,传统上一些数据可视化的工艺流程同样能通过 2D 组态来实现:换热站远程监控系统 ?

55540

Leaflet 高德继续碰撞火花!

之后,又将高德和该包相结合,介绍了前期需要准备的工作,见:Leaflet 高德合并会擦出怎么样的火花?。这一期就到了绘制地图环节,下面分享三类数据的绘制教程。...绘制地图 3.1 散点地图绘制 高德地图替换 leaflet 自带的底图 由于 leaflet 自带的底图不是很合规,所以我们使用高德地图进行替换。...parallel 和 foreach 等来实现并行访问和解析 api,因为 R 语言默认是单核运行的,所以会出现**“一核有难,多核围观”**的情形,使用并行运算可以使电脑发挥出多核的优势,提升数据处理速度...有数据的朋友也可以直接把数据整理下就行,下面的例子使用上面绘制散点地图的数据。...本教程使用的是高德的底图,所以可以直接使用高德提供的审图号。如果是来历不明的地图数据,无法提供审图号可能会引来一些不必要的麻烦。

3K20

告别传统工业互联网,提高数字管控思维:三维组态分布式能源站

而 Hightopo(以下简称 HT )的 HT for Web 产品上的 web 组态提供了丰富的 2D 组态和 3D 组态效果,可以根据需求快速实现一套完整的数据可视化系统。...还可以自定义修改一些交互或者视角上的限制,如修改左右键的交互方式或者设置场景的最大仰角,都能使用户在交互体验上更为流畅。...,我们可以通过 ht.PolyLine 绘制出流程所经的路径,通过 ht.Default.startAnim() 动画函数去执行调用变化管道上的 uv 贴图的偏移值,就可以达到流动的效果。...为了给精彩的 HTML web 组态添加上绚丽的颜色,HT 在 2D 组态和 3D 组态上不断地完善,可以通过 2/3D 融合的场景图纸搭建出一个个好玩的可视化系统。...而作为在 3D 组态上可以呈现出多样化效果下搭建的可视化系统场景,传统上一些数据可视化的工艺流程同样能通过 2D 组态来实现:换热站远程监控系统

47210

告别传统工业互联网,提高数字管控思维:三维组态分布式能源站

可以自定义修改一些交互或者视角上的限制,如修改左右键的交互方式或者设置场景的最大仰角,都能使用户在交互体验上更为流畅。...,我们可以通过 ht.PolyLine 绘制出流程所经的路径,通过 ht.Default.startAnim() 动画函数去执行调用变化管道上的 uv 贴图的偏移值,就可以达到流动的效果。...billboard 同样是基于 ht.Shape 的子类,对于 Shape 不管是在 2D 组态或者是 3D 组态上呈现,都可以通过一些定义的属性 styleMap 来设定一些本身自带的属性值,当然用户也可以自己通过在...为了给精彩的 HTML web 组态添加上绚丽的颜色,HT 在 2D 组态和 3D 组态上不断地完善,可以通过 2/3D 融合的场景图纸搭建出一个个好玩的可视化系统。...而作为在 3D 组态上可以呈现出多样化效果下搭建的可视化系统场景,传统上一些数据可视化的工艺流程同样能通过 2D 组态来实现:换热站远程监控系统 ?

38820

基于 HTML5 WebGL 的楼宇智能化集成系统(一)

IBMS 更多突出的是管理方面的功能,即如何的全面实现优化控制和管理,节能降耗、高效、舒适、环境安全这样一个目的,可以这样说,判断一个建筑物是否具有智能建筑特点,要看它是否具有 IBMS 的系统集成。...代码实现 一、场景搭建 界面通过 2D 图纸叠加在3D 场景上来实现 2D 界面 3D 场景的融合,2D 界面通过自动布局的机制实现了手机端电脑端的响应式呈现。...可以通过了解到更多视图数据模型之间的内容。...同样,我搭建了一个 2D 的场景用来放置我们的 json 矢量图,利用 ht.Default.xhrLoad 函数 json 矢量背景图反序列化显示在 2D 面板数据。...; center:新的目标中心点位置(相机看向的位置),形如[148, -400, 171],如果为 null 则使用当前中心点位置; animation:默认 false,是否启用动画,可以设置为 true

1.7K40

Lua连续教程之Lua中表的使用

使用表,Lua语言可以一种简单、统一且高效的方式表示数组、集合、记录和其他很多数据结果。Lua语言也使用表来表示包和其他对象。...x = 0 , y = 1} -- polyline[4] } 上述的示例也同时展示了如何创建嵌套表表达更加复杂的数据结构。...虽然总是有效,但是否加最后一个逗号是可选的。 这种灵活性使得开发人员在编写表构造器时不需要对最后一个元素进行特殊处理。 最后,表构造器中的逗号也可以使用分号代替,这主要是为了兼容Lua语言的旧版本。...因此,上述列表{10,20,30}是等价的,其长度为3,而不是5. 可以将以nil结尾的列表当作一种非常特殊的情况。不过,很多列表时通过逐个添加各个元素创建出来的。...栈的实现为例,我们可以使用t = {}来表示栈,Push操作可以使用table.insert(t,x)实现,Pop操作可以使用table.remove(t)实现,调用table.insert(t,1,

1.4K40
领券